The Power Systems Resilience Group (PSR) within the Electrification and Energy Infrastructures Division (EEID) at the Oak Ridge National Laboratory (ORNL) is seeking to fill a Senior R&D Staff position to work in the area of power system protection research and development. Selection will be based on qualifications, relevant experience, skills, and education.
PSR Group R&D supports DOE’s Office of Electricity (OE), Office of Cybersecurity, Energy Security and Emergency Response (CESER) and Office of Energy Efficiency and Renewable Energy (EERE) initiatives on: electric grid resilience and reliability; grid modeling and analysis; integration of new technologies; and identifying and validating new ways of using existing grid assets to ensure grid reliability, grid resilience, environmental stewardship, and affordability of energy supplies. PSR conducts modeling, analysis and R&D specifically related to the grid and applies PSR’s expertise to other technologies and generation assets, such as hydropower, to develop and evaluate options and methodologies for operations, dispatch, and planning.
The successful Senior R&D candidate will be responsible for conducting research and managing research projects supporting PSR Group activities focused on transmission, substation and distribution system protective relaying and protection engineering. The selected candidate will lead the expansion of R&D in the PSR Group to take advantage of our multidisciplinary capabilities, multimodal strengths, and unique tools and capabilities. The candidate should be a proven thought leader in developing new power system protection methods for existing and future power delivery systems incorporating large amounts of renewable generation. The candidate is expected to work in support of other ORNL staff and to offer career guidance and mentoring to junior staff. They will be expected to network and develop collaborative R&D with other groups and divisions internally at ORNL as well as with the DOE and industry. There will be frequent interactions with DOE sponsors in pursuit of new research funding.
